Skip to content

Commit

Permalink
uodate list of packages with CLINT birds
Browse files Browse the repository at this point in the history
  • Loading branch information
nilshempelmann committed Dec 17, 2024
1 parent a5c11a3 commit 1f50a41
Showing 1 changed file with 56 additions and 76 deletions.
132 changes: 56 additions & 76 deletions docs/list_ClimateServicesApplicationPackages.md
Original file line number Diff line number Diff line change
@@ -1,76 +1,56 @@
# Application Packages for Climate Resilience Information Systems

Here is a list of active software packages to be used to spin off technical climate resilience information systems (CRIS). CRIS can be used to underpinn consulting climate services with information on demand.

```{figure} /media/Birdhouse_Schema.png
:scale: 50%
```
The figure shows an overview of climate Application Packages for CRIS.




```{list-table} Application Packages for Climate Resilience Information Systems
:header-rows: 1
:name: tab-climate-application-packages
* - Software Component
- Usage
- Development stage
* - [Birdhouse](http://bird-house.github.io/)
- Collection of OGC based application packages for CRIS
- Organization in GitHub
* - [Twitcher](http://twitcher.readthedocs.io/)
- Security Proxy for WPS, WCS, WMS
- Deployed in [PAVICS](https://pavics-sdi.readthedocs.io/en/latest/)
* - [Phoenix](https://pyramid-phoenix.readthedocs.io/en/latest/)
- Graphical User Interphase Frontend
- Deployed at [CLINT Demonstrator](clint.dkrz.de)
* - [Magpie](https://pavics-magpie.readthedocs.io/en/latest/)
-
-
* - [cookiecutter-birdhouse](https://cookiecutter-birdhouse.readthedocs.io)
- Utility to create an OGC API Processes application package skeleton
- Version 0.5
* - [birdy](https://birdy.readthedocs.io)
- Python WPS client to call a serverside deployed application package
- Version 0.8.1
* - [emu](https://emu.readthedocs.io/)
- Demo and testing application for training purpose
- Version 0.12
* - [finch](https://pavics-sdi.readthedocs.io/)
- application package for processing services to calculate climate indices
- Deployed in [Climatedata.ca](Climatedata.ca) and [PAVICS](https://pavics.ouranos.ca)
* - [flyingpigon](https://flyingpigeon.readthedocs.io)
- Test-suite
- Deployed in [PAVICS](https://pavics.ouranos.ca)
* - [rooks](https://github.com/roocs)
- Remote operations on climate simulations
- Deployed in [COPERNICUS Climate Data Store (CDS)](https://cds.climate.copernicus.eu/#!/home) and CEDA
* - [ravenWPS](https://pavics-sdi.readthedocs.io/projects/raven/en/latest/notebooks/index.html)
- Hydrological modelling
- Deployed in [PAVICS](https://pavics.ouranos.ca)
* - [hummingbird](http://birdhouse-hummingbird.readthedocs.io/)
- data compliance checker
- DKRZ internal usage
* - [goldfinch](https://github.com/cedadev/goldfinch)
- filtering and extraction of MIDAS data
- Deployed at CEDA
* - [duck](https://climateintelligence.github.io/smartduck-docs/sections/duck.html)
- AI enhanced process to Fill in missing values
- Deployed at [CLINT Demonstrator](clint.dkrz.de)
* - [pelican](https://github.com/bird-house/pelican)
- WPS supporting ESGF compute API
-
* - [WEAVER](https://pavics-weaver.readthedocs.io/en/latest/)
- Implementation following OGC API - Processes best practices.
- [OGC EO-Pilot](http://docs.opengeospatial.org/per/20-045.html%23_open_source_software_4&sa=D&source=editors&ust=1660816924243900&usg=AOvVaw22QBuuFacKi801Tvd-c-LC)
* - [Rooki](https://www.google.com/url?q=https://github.com/roocs/rooki&sa=D&source=editors&ust=1660816924244993&usg=AOvVaw1PeZJ1lymJDD331QwFM55x)
- PYTHON Library
-
* - [RavenWPS](https://pavics-sdi.readthedocs.io/projects/raven/en/latest/notebooks/index.html)
- Hydrological modelling
- Deployed in [PAVICS](https://pavics.ouranos.ca)
```
# Climate Services Application Packages

Here is a list of active software packages, applications and utilities to be used to spin off technical climate services information systems.

## Central collection of Application Packages

| Name and Documentation | Usage | Source |
| -------- | ------- | ------- |
| [Birdhouse](http://bird-house.github.io/) | Collection of OGC based application packages for CRIS | Organization in GitHub |

## Utilities, Clients and Frontend Components

| Name and Documentation | Usage | Source |
| -------- | ------- | ------- |
| [Twitcher](http://twitcher.readthedocs.io/) | Security Proxy for WPS, WCS, WMS | Deployed in [PAVICS](https://pavics-sdi.readthedocs.io/en/latest/) |
| [cookiecutter-birdhouse](https://cookiecutter-birdhouse.readthedocs.io) | Utility to create an OGC API Processes application package skeleton | Version 0.5 |
| [birdy](https://birdy.readthedocs.io) | Python WPS client to call a serverside deployed application package | Version 0.8.1 |
| [Phoenix](https://pyramid-phoenix.readthedocs.io/en/latest/) | Graphical User Interphase Frontend | Deployed at [CLINT Demonstrator](clint.dkrz.de) |
| [Rooki](https://www.google.com/url?q=https://github.com/roocs/rooki&sa=D&source=editors&ust=1660816924244993&usg=AOvVaw1PeZJ1lymJDD331QwFM55x) | PYTHON Library | |


## Climate Services Application Packages based on OGC API Processes

| [WEAVER](https://pavics-weaver.readthedocs.io/en/latest/) | Implementation following OGC API - Processes best practices. | |

## Climate Services Application Packages based on OGC WPS including AI

| Name and Documentation | Usage | Source |
| -------- | ------- | ------- |
| [duck](https://climateintelligence.github.io/smartduck-docs/sections/duck.html) | AI enhanced process to Fill in missing values | Deployed at [CLINT Demonstrator](clint.dkrz.de) |
| [hawk](https://clint-hawk.readthedocs.io/en/latest/) | ------- | [Hawk Github Repository](https://github.com/climateintelligence/hawk)|
| [albatross](https://clint-albatross.readthedocs.io/en/latest/) | ------- | [Albatross GitHub Repository](https://github.com/climateintelligence/albatross) |
| [shearwater](https://shearwater.readthedocs.io/en/latest/)| ------- | [Shearwater GitHub Repository](https://github.com/climateintelligence/shearwater) |
| [owl](https://clint-owl.readthedocs.io/en/latest/) | ------- | [Owl GitHub Repository](https://github.com/climateintelligence/owl) |
| [dipper](https://clint-dipper.readthedocs.io/en/latest/) | ------- | [Dipper GitHub Repository](https://github.com/climateintelligence/dipper) |

## Climate Services Application Packages based on OGC WPS

| Name and Documentation | Usage | Source |
| -------- | ------- | ------- |
| [Magpie](https://pavics-magpie.readthedocs.io/en/latest/) | | |
| [emu](https://emu.readthedocs.io/) | Demo and testing application for training purpose | Version 0.12 |
| [finch](https://pavics-sdi.readthedocs.io/) | application package for processing services to calculate climate indices | Deployed in [Climatedata.ca](Climatedata.ca) and [PAVICS](https://pavics.ouranos.ca) |
| [flyingpigon](https://flyingpigeon.readthedocs.io) | Test-suite | Deployed in [PAVICS](https://pavics.ouranos.ca) |
| [rooks](https://github.com/roocs) | Remote operations on climate simulations | Deployed in [COPERNICUS Climate Data Store (CDS)](https://cds.climate.copernicus.eu/#!/home) and CEDA |
| [raven](https://pavics-sdi.readthedocs.io/projects/raven/en/latest/notebooks/index.html) | Hydrological modelling | Deployed in [PAVICS](https://pavics.ouranos.ca) |
| [hummingbird](http://birdhouse-hummingbird.readthedocs.io/) | data compliance checker | DKRZ internal usage |
| [goldfinch](https://github.com/cedadev/goldfinch) | filtering and extraction of MIDAS data | Deployed at CEDA |
| [pelican](https://github.com/bird-house/pelican) | WPS supporting ESGF compute API | |


<!--
| [OGC EO-Pilot](http://docs.opengeospatial.org/per/20-045.html%23_open_source_software_4&amp;sa=D&amp;source=editors&amp;ust=1660816924243900&amp;usg=AOvVaw22QBuuFacKi801Tvd-c-LC) | | |
-->

0 comments on commit 1f50a41

Please sign in to comment.